Skip to content

Bump stwo-cairo.#378

Open
ilyalesokhin-starkware wants to merge 1 commit into
ilya/basefrom
ilya/sharp-7.4
Open

Bump stwo-cairo.#378
ilyalesokhin-starkware wants to merge 1 commit into
ilya/basefrom
ilya/sharp-7.4

Conversation

@ilyalesokhin-starkware

@ilyalesokhin-starkware ilyalesokhin-starkware commented Jul 2, 2026

Copy link
Copy Markdown
Contributor

This change is Reviewable

@cursor

cursor Bot commented Jul 2, 2026

Copy link
Copy Markdown

PR Summary

Medium Risk
Touches the Cairo proving/verification dependency graph; behavior changes depend on upstream stwo-cairo between commits, and dual revisions in the lockfile merit checking prove/verify tests.

Overview
Updates the workspace stwo-cairo git dependencies (cairo-air, stwo-cairo-utils, stwo-cairo-adapter, stwo-cairo-prover, stwo-cairo-serialize, stwo-cairo-common) from commit a837f0e to ce55c753, with Cargo.lock regenerated to match.

The lockfile now carries two stwo-cairo revisions: workspace crates resolve to ce55c753, while stwo-circuits (unchanged pin) still pulls a837f0e for privacy/circuit verifier paths. No Rust source changes—only dependency pins.

Reviewed by Cursor Bugbot for commit a50c792. Bugbot is set up for automated code reviews on this repo. Configure here.

@codecov

codecov Bot commented Jul 2, 2026

Copy link
Copy Markdown

Codecov Report

✅ All modified and coverable lines are covered by tests.
✅ Project coverage is 64.29%. Comparing base (0b5d6af) to head (a50c792).

Additional details and impacted files
@@            Coverage Diff             @@
##           ilya/base     #378   +/-   ##
==========================================
  Coverage      64.29%   64.29%           
==========================================
  Files             39       39           
  Lines           5613     5613           
==========================================
  Hits            3609     3609           
  Misses          2004     2004           
🚀 New features to boost your workflow:
  • ❄️ Test Analytics: Detect flaky tests, report on failures, and find test suite problems.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ant